💡 Tips
- Carry your passport when visiting the Wing 5 Air Force base to access Ao Manao beach; registration at the gate is mandatory.
- Rent a bicycle to explore the authentic Khlong Wan fishing village; it is the most relaxed way to get around.
- Look for the friendly dusky leaf monkeys (langurs) at the foot of Khao Lom Muak; they are much gentler than common macaques.
- Note that climbing the Khao Lom Muak peak is only permitted on specific long holiday weekends.
- Visit the Prachuap Khiri Khan night market, located just 10 minutes away by car along the sea promenade.

Khlong Wan is famous for high-quality dried squid and fish; buy them directly from the fishing families in the village.
Try the affordable and fresh seafood at the open-air food court inside the Wing 5 base, right by the beach.

Khlong Wan is a welcoming coastal village in Prachuap Khiri Khan Province, offering travelers a glimpse into traditional Thai fishing life. Unlike bustling tourist hubs, a serene calm prevails here. The waterfront is lined with cozy guesthouses and excellent seafood restaurants serving the day's fresh catch. The main beach in the area is Hat Wa Ko, a long, pine-fringed stretch of coastline. It is historically significant as King Mongkut observed a solar eclipse here in 1868. Today, the area houses the King Mongkut Memorial Park of Science and Technology, which features an impressive aquarium that is particularly popular with families. The surroundings offer shallow, calm waters handy for relaxation. The village architecture has remained largely traditional, making Khlong Wan an excellent destination for those seeking authentic culture. Access is typically through the nearby city of Prachuap Khiri Khan, which is well-connected to Thailand's southern railway line.
